What is Megajoule to Nanoelectron-volt Conversion?
Megajoule (MJ) and nanoelectron-volt (neV) are both units used to measure energy, but they serve different purposes depending on the scale of the measurement. If you ever need to convert megajoule to nanoelectron-volt, knowing the exact conversion formula is essential.
MJ to nev Conversion Formula:
One Megajoule is equal to 6241509074460762607776240981000000 Nanoelectron-volt.
Formula: 1 MJ = 6241509074460762607776240981000000 neV
By using this conversion factor, you can easily convert any energy from megajoule to nanoelectron-volt with precision.
Convert 0.2 Megajoule to Nanoelectron-volt
To convert 0.2 megajoule to nanoelectron-volt, multiply the value by 6241509074460762607776240981000000 since:
1 megajoule = 6241509074460762607776240981000000 nanoelectron-volt
So:
0.2 × 6241509074460762607776240981000000 = 1.248302e+33
Result: 0.2 megajoule = 1.248302e+33 nanoelectron-volt
